In the past, alumni have accompanied current YIRA members to the United Nations headquarters, as well as joined students at dinners, lectures, and discussion panels, including a theater trip to Manhattan. It was two years ago that an alumni contact made it possible for the Yale Model UN Team to attend the World MUN conference in Heidelberg, Germany and visit the Foreign Ministry as well as provide the opportunity to meet important figures from one of the political parties in Germany.
